Digital Projection Power 7gv

With a single objective in mind...

Digital Projection, determined to revolutionize the large screen projection market, has implemented extraordinary technologies to engineer POWER Displays, a range of large venue projectors with exceptional imaging capabilities and inspired operational simplicity.

Perfectly suited for entertainment, business, education, simulation, religion, command and control, broadcast, cinema and staging environments, no other light valve technology approaches the visual beauty and operational simplicity of a Digital Projection POWER Display.

At 6500 ANSI lumens, The POWER 7gv is the brightest DLP based projector available anywhere and produces dazzling projected images for any application. The astonishing brightness of the projector is complimented by a palate of more than 1 billion colors, absolute grayscale tracking and luminance uniformity greater than 90%. The on-screen results are engaging video, HDTV and computer imagery with an inherent "film-like" appeal.

The POWER 7gv delivers these outstanding performance benefits:

  • Super-high-brightness of 6500 ANSI lumens - Bright enough for any application.
  • 350:1 On to Off Contrast, 200:1 ANSI Contrast produces deep blacks and rich detail.
  • Greater than 90% luminance uniformity for perfectly "flat" imagery with no hot-spots.
  • Source compatibility up to 1280 x 1024 pixels provides brood computer display flexibility.
  • A high native resolution of 1024 x 768 for exceptional Non screens detail.
  • State of the art composite video decoding technology by Faroudja Laboratories.
  • Advanced signal processing and image resizing by Cintel International.
  • Solid state digital stability and factory preset convergence for fast and simple alignment.
  • Motorized Lens Mount with horizontal and vertical ship provides broad installation agility.
  • Proprietary, pre-targeted xenon lamps assure lamp replacement is fast and easy.

Technical Specifications

 Light Output 6500 ANSI Lumens (±5%)
 Brightness Linearity (edge to center) >90% edge to center
Color Temperature 3000K - 9300K Adjustable
Contrast Ratio >200:1 ANSI checkerboard
>350:1 Full Field
Display Type 3 X DMD
DMD Resolution 1024 x768 Pixel
16.3µm x 16.3µm pixel size
17µm x 17µm pixel pitch
17.4mm X 13.1mm DMD size
Input Specifications 3 Independently configurable inputs-selectable via remote control. BNC connectors.
525/60, 625/50, PAL, NTSC, SECAM, HDTV, VGA, SVGA, XGA & MAC
Auto Select
Optional Direct Digital Input
RGBS RGB = 700 mV / 75 OHM
S = 0.7 V - 5 V
Sync on G, Separate H & V,
Composite Sync Auto Select
Component (Y , R - Y, B - Y) Y = 700 mV + 300 mV / 75 OHM
R - Y, B - Y = 700 mV p - p / 75 OHM
Y/C (S video) Y = 700 mV + 300 mV / 75 OHM
C = 300 mV p - p / 75 OHM
Composite Video 1 V p - p / 75 OHM
Computer H = 15 kHZ to 90 kHz
V = 24 Hz to 100 Hz
Remote Control IR Receivers front and rear.
Hard wire link to handset
9 Pin D type connector
Automation RS232 input / output
loop-through, 9 Pin D type connector
Switcher Separate Audio & Video Switcher outputs
-RS232, 9 Pin D type
Lamp Type Proprietary Xenon Arc
Mounting Floor mount (standard)
Flying Frame (optional)
Rigging Frame (optional)
Stacking Frame (optional)
Lens Mount Motorized focus, horizontal and vertical lens shift accessed via remote control
Lens Options 0.82: 1
1.0 : 1
1.5 - 2.5 : 1 Zoom
2.5 - 4.0 : 1 Zoom
4.0 - 7.0 : 1 Zoom
Physical Dimensions 373mm (14.7") height
660mm ( 26") width
976mm (38.5") length
Weight (incl. std lens) 91 Kg (200 lbs)
Power Requirements 208 - 240 V ac 50 - 60 Hz
3000 watts
